`
在水伊方
  • 浏览: 111012 次
  • 性别: Icon_minigender_1
  • 来自: 福州
社区版块
存档分类
最新评论

Spring环境搭建

 
阅读更多

Spring是一个开源的控制反转(Inversion of Control ,IoC)和面向切面(AOP)的容器框架.它的主要目的是简化企业开发。

 

搭建环境步骤:

1、到http://www.springsource.org/download下载spring,我用的是spring-framework-2.5.6的版本

 

2、导入2个常用包

     spring-framework-2.5.6\dist\spring.jar
     spring-framework-2.5.6\lib\jakarta-commons\commons-logging

 

3、创建spring.xml文件(该配置模版可以从spring的参考手册或spring的例子中得到,文件的取名是任意的)

<?xml version="1.0" encoding="UTF-8"?>  
<beans xmlns="http://www.springframework.org/schema/beans"  
    x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"  
    xsi:schemaLocation="http://www.springframework.org/schema/beans   
           http://www.springframework.org/schema/beans/spring-beans-2.5.xsd">  
           
</beans>  

 

4、实例化spring容器
     实例化Spring容器常用的两种方式:

 

     方法一:
     在类路径下寻找配置文件来实例化容器
     ApplicationContext ctx = new ClassPathXmlApplicationContext(new String[]{"beans.xml"});

 

     方法二:
     在文件系统路径下寻找配置文件来实例化容器
     ApplicationContext ctx = new FileSystemXmlApplicationContext(new String[]{“d:\\beans.xml“});

     Spring的配置文件可以指定多个,可以通过String数组传入。

 

5.编写测试类,测试Spring环境是否搭建成功

package org.spring;

import org.junit.Test;
import org.springframework.context.ApplicationContext;
import org.springframework.context.support.ClassPathXmlApplicationContext;

public class SpringTest {
	@Test
	public void test() {
		ApplicationContext ctx = new ClassPathXmlApplicationContext(
				"spring.xml");
		
	}
}

 

6、控制台信息

 控制台没有出现错误信息,环境搭建成功

 

7、工程目录结构图

 

  • 大小: 18.7 KB
  • 大小: 22.2 KB
分享到:
评论

相关推荐

    spring环境搭建基础用例

    通过这个基础的Spring环境搭建,你将能够了解Spring的基本运作机制和Bean的管理方式。随着对Spring框架的深入学习,你会发现更多高级特性,如AOP(面向切面编程)、数据访问支持、Web MVC框架等,这些都是SSH框架中...

    Eclipse 搭建Spring 开发环境

    Spring 开发环境搭建完成后,可以进行 Spring 项目的开发和测试。该环境提供了一个强大且灵活的开发平台,能够满足大型项目的需求。 Spring Framework 是一个开源框架,提供了许多强大的功能,例如依赖注入、AOP ...

    FLEX_Spring环境搭建

    以下是关于"FLEX_Spring环境搭建"的详细知识讲解: 1. **FLEX介绍**: FLEX是Adobe开发的用于创建动态、交互式Web应用程序的工具。它基于ActionScript编程语言和Flex SDK,提供了MXML和AS3两种编程方式。MXML用于...

    spring环境搭建

    在进行Spring环境搭建时,我们首先要确保计算机上已经安装了Java Development Kit (JDK) 并设置了正确的环境变量。接下来,我们将详细介绍Spring环境的搭建过程,以及如何使用最少的jar包进行配置。 1. **下载...

    struts+spring环境搭建

    在本文中,我们将深入探讨Struts2.x和Spring的集成环境搭建及其相关知识点。 1. **Struts2.x简介** - **Action类的区别**:Struts1的Action类需要继承抽象基类,而Struts2的Action类可以实现Action接口或其他接口...

    mybatis整合spring环境搭建

    本文将详细介绍如何进行MyBatis与Spring的整合,搭建一个完整的开发环境。 首先,我们需要理解MyBatis和Spring的基本概念。MyBatis是一个优秀的持久层框架,它简化了SQL操作,通过XML或注解方式配置和映射原生信息...

    java strurs+hibernate+spring环境搭建与配置

    通过上述步骤,一个基础的Java Struts、Hibernate和Spring的开发环境就搭建完成了。这样的环境可以处理用户请求、执行业务逻辑、访问数据库并返回响应。然而,这只是最基础的配置,实际项目中还需要考虑异常处理、...

    strut+ibatis+spring环境搭建

    这个整合环境搭建的过程是企业级应用开发中常见的一种模式,它将MVC的控制逻辑、业务逻辑和数据访问层有效地解耦,提高了代码的可维护性和可扩展性。通过Spring的事务管理,保证了数据操作的一致性和完整性。

    maven搭建spring环境代码

    关于"tuziFileExplorer"这个文件,看起来可能是一个示例项目或者文件浏览器工具,但因为没有提供具体信息,无法详细解释其在Spring环境搭建中的作用。通常,如果它是项目的一部分,它可能包含了具体的Spring配置或...

    spring 源码环境搭建

    Spring 源码环境搭建指南 在本文档中,我们将详细介绍如何搭建 Spring 源码环境,帮助读者快速入门 Spring 源码阅读。 标题解释 "spring 源码环境搭建" 是指搭建一个可以读取和编译 Spring 源码的开发环境。Spring...

    Spring+mybatis环境搭建

    Spring+MyBatis环境搭建 本篇资源摘要信息主要介绍了如何搭建Spring 3.0.6 + MyBatis 3.0.6环境。该环境搭建主要分为两个部分:准备工作和搭建环境。 准备工作 在搭建环境之前,需要准备好所需的文件和工具。这些...

    springcloud环境搭建入门

    在本文中,我们将深入探讨如何搭建一个基础的SpringCloud环境,包括设置Eureka服务注册中心、Ribbon负载均衡配置、Zuul网关配置以及分布式配置中心的配置。这些都是SpringCloud框架中的关键组件,用于构建高效、可靠...

    springmvc环境搭建及入门的例子

    包含springMVC3.1的所有jar包,springmvc环境搭建及入门的例子,helloword,

    Spring 环境搭建、依赖注入、控制反转、面向切面编程、数据库交互 知识点思维导图

    大致可参考,此文档中可查各知识点一些描述,博文中看不了 https://blog.csdn.net/liuhenghui5201/article/details/88208325

    基于注解Spring MVC环境搭建

    在“基于注解的Spring MVC环境搭建”中,我们将深入探讨如何利用注解来简化配置,快速建立一个运行中的Web项目。这篇博文(尽管描述为空,但提供了链接)很可能是关于创建一个基本的Spring MVC项目并使用注解来管理...

Global site tag (gtag.js) - Google Analytics